Ezgjan Alioski has left Leeds after failing to agree a new contract, the Premier League club have confirmed. “I knew Gjanni was going to be special the moment he walked into the building,” said Orta. “Even with this in mind he exceeded my expectations. Gjanni has been exceptional both on and off the field, his team mates will miss him greatly, as will all of the staff at Thorp Arch and Elland Road. “We thank Gjanni for all of his efforts and we wish him every success for the future.”Alioski played 36 of Leeds’ 38 games in the Premier League last season, scoring twice, as Marcelo Bielsa’s team finished ninth on their return to the top flight.
